HOUSE RESOLUTION

 
2    WHEREAS, The Williamsville High School baseball team,
3proudly known as the Bullets, have achieved another year of
4honorable sportsmanship and victories on the field; and
 
5    WHEREAS, The Bullets have won an amazing 5 consecutive
6Sangamo Conference titles, finishing this year's season with a
7spectacular 31-7 record; and
 
8    WHEREAS, Coach Jess Buttry is in his ninth year serving as
9Head Coach of the Bullets and fourteenth year of service at
10Williamsville High School, leading 4 teams to a combined 112-25
11record; and
 
12    WHEREAS, The players of the Williamsville High School
13baseball team, John Beal, Justin Beggs, Luke Bleyer, Austin
14Brown, Brandon Bunger, Adam Clark, Dan Daykin, Dayton Edwards,
15Sam Fanale, Talon File, Drew Keenan, Logan Kramer, Andrew
16Roberts, Joe Roscetti, Vince Vignali, and KJ Woods, have all
17become better men and teammates through Coach Buttry's intense
18leadership and go-getter philosophy; and
 
19    WHEREAS, During the 2A State Championship, the Bullets
20never stopped fighting for victory, even to the last inning of
21the final game; although the Bullets did not win the

 

 

HR0595- 2 -LRB099 12765 GRL 36573 r

1Championship this year, the team outhit the Rockford Christian
2Royal Lions 8-7; Williamsville players continue to prove
3themselves as a force to be reckoned with each and every
4season; therefore, be it
 
5    RESOLVED, BY THE H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VES OF THE
6NINETY-NINTH GENERAL ASSEMBLY OF THE STATE OF ILLINOIS, that we
7congratulate the members of the Williamsville Bullets on the
8occasion of their successful season and for their countless
9hours of dedication and intense effort which allowed them to
10perform so impressively; and be it further
 
11    RESOLVED, That suitable copies of this resolution be
12presented to Coach Buttry and the entire Williamsville High
13School baseball team as a symbol of our admiration and respect.
